Description

This letter to the Colossians reminds Christians that they are "God's chosen people, holy and dearly loved" (3:12). It proclaims the deity of Jesus using some of the loftiest language in all the New Testament to help the church know God in his greatness and glory. Jesus makes believers alive to God and sets them on the path to right living. This proper view of Christ serves as the antidote for heresy and a building block for Christian life and doctrine both then and now.

Colossians, A Video Study features scholar David E. Garland teaching through the book of Colossians in 10 engaging and challenging lessons. A companion to Garland's Colossians, Philemon in the NIV Application Commentary series, these lessons explore the links between the Bible and our own times that reveal the letter's enduring relevance for our twenty-first-century lives.

Colossians, A Video Study is part of the Zondervan Beyond the Basics Video Series, which is dedicated to bringing expert teaching from the world's best biblical scholars and theologians directly to interested learners.

Author: Garland, David E.
David E. Garland (PhD, Southern Baptist Theological Seminary) is William B. Hinson Professor of Christian Scriptures and dean for academic affairs at George W. Truett Seminary, Baylor University. He is the New Testament editor for the revised Expositor's Bible Commentary and the author of various books and commentaries, including Mark and Colossians/Philemon in the NIV Application Commentary, and the article on Mark in the Zondervan Illustrated Bible Backgrounds Commentary. He and his wife, Diana, reside in Waco, Texas.
